Transaction 43e515efc4778c95d78d99312df18e9a3106ed0ba3ebe422809d1acc9979da4e

1 Input
2 Outputs
  • 43e515efc4778c95d78d99312df18e9a3106ed0ba3ebe422809d1acc9979da4e:0
  • value  198404824
    address  18vTgV7XCockoD9cqNrA5UR3ctKjj12usH
  • 43e515efc4778c95d78d99312df18e9a3106ed0ba3ebe422809d1acc9979da4e:1
  • value  30000000
    address  3DdaHm5ZUAyikeJFkTfnwAZUxPPe8t2Lxe